Fighting Scots Battle Clarion To 1-1 Tie

CLARION, Pa. (Oct. 9, 2012) – The Edinboro women's soccer team fought to a 1-1 draw with Pennsylvania State Athletic Conference rival Clarion on Wednesday night in double overtime.

The Fighting Scots (8-3-1, 5-3-1 PSAC) held a large advantage in shots during the contest, firing off 23 shot attempts to just 14 from Clarion (2-7-4, 2-6-2). Eleven shots were off target and 11 more were turned away by Clarion goalie Laura Saussol, however.

Clarion got on the board first in the 24th minute when the Golden Eagles turned a corner kick into the first offense of the game as Casey Harsch tallied the goal for a 1-0 lead.

Edinboro tied things shortly before half time. PSAC leading goal-scorer Liz Debo added to her season total with her 10th goal of the year at the 44:33 mark off an assist from senior Amanda Bartell.

That would be the extent of the scoring, however. Edinboro and Clarion played a scoreless second half, sending the teams to overtime. The Scots had a shot attempt from Kelsey Knoll at 96:50 for the only shot on goal of the first overtime, but it was stopped by Saussol. Edinboro had the only shot on goal of the second overtime as well when Reilee DuPratt had a shot attempt at 106:38 that was saved by Saussol.

Meghan Kelly had five saves for Edinboro.

The Fighting Scots return to action on Saturday evening against Indiana (Pa.) at Sox Harrison Stadium. That match will kick off at 6:30 p.m. and is part of Cancer Awareness Day with donations being taken to benefit the Leukemia/Lymphoma Society.
